Traditional Quinceanera Attire: Embracing Cultural Heritage

In the realm of traditional quinceanera attire, the vibrant tapestry of cultural heritage unfolds, inviting us to embrace the beauty and significance of this cherished celebration. As a young woman prepares for this momentous occasion, the choice of her attire becomes a profound expression of her identity and the rich traditions that have shaped her.

The traditional quinceanera gown, a breathtaking masterpiece, embodies the essence of femininity and grace. Its voluminous skirt, adorned with intricate embroidery and shimmering embellishments, evokes the grandeur of a princess. The bodice, meticulously crafted with lace and delicate beading, accentuates the wearer’s youthful beauty. The vibrant colors, often hues of pink, blue, or green, symbolize the vibrancy and joy of this special day.

Beyond its aesthetic appeal, the quinceanera gown carries deep cultural significance. Its design often incorporates elements that pay homage to the young woman’s heritage. For those of Mexican descent, the gown may feature traditional embroidery patterns inspired by indigenous textiles. For those with Puerto Rican roots, the gown may incorporate the vibrant colors and folkloric motifs of the island’s culture.

The accessories that accompany the quinceanera gown are equally important. A tiara, adorned with sparkling crystals or delicate flowers, crowns the young woman’s head, symbolizing her transition into adulthood. A bouquet of fresh flowers, carefully chosen to reflect her personality and the season, adds a touch of elegance and fragrance.

The shoes, often adorned with intricate beading or embroidery, complete the ensemble. They represent the journey that the young woman is about to embark on, as she steps into a new chapter of her life.

In addition to the traditional gown, many quinceaneras also choose to wear a traditional headdress known as a “mantilla.” This delicate lace veil, often adorned with pearls or sequins, adds an air of mystery and sophistication to the overall look.

The choice of attire for a quinceanera is not merely a matter of fashion but a reflection of the young woman’s cultural heritage and the values that she holds dear. As she steps into her new role as a young adult, her quinceanera attire becomes a symbol of her pride, her identity, and the rich traditions that have shaped her.

Budget-Friendly Quinceanera Outfits: Looking Fabulous Without Breaking the Bank

As the day of your quinceañera approaches, the excitement and anticipation reach their peak. Amidst the whirlwind of preparations, choosing the perfect outfit is paramount. However, finding a stunning gown that aligns with your budget can seem like a daunting task. Fear not, for there are countless ways to achieve a fabulous look without breaking the bank.

First and foremost, consider renting a gown. Rental services offer a wide selection of exquisite dresses at a fraction of the cost of purchasing one. This option allows you to don a designer gown that would otherwise be out of reach. Additionally, you can explore consignment shops or thrift stores for gently used gowns that are often in excellent condition. With a keen eye and a bit of patience, you may stumble upon a hidden gem that perfectly suits your style.

If purchasing a new gown is your preference, there are budget-friendly options available. Online retailers often offer discounts and sales, especially during off-season periods. Take advantage of these opportunities to snag a beautiful gown at a reduced price. Moreover, consider purchasing a gown from a less well-known designer or a smaller boutique. These establishments may offer gowns of comparable quality at a lower cost.

Accessories can elevate any outfit, and they don’t have to be expensive. Statement jewelry, such as a bold necklace or earrings, can add a touch of glamour to a simple gown. Consider borrowing accessories from friends or family members to complete your look. Additionally, DIY projects can be a fun and cost-effective way to create unique accessories that reflect your personality.

Shoes are an essential part of any ensemble, and for a quinceañera, heels are a traditional choice. However, if heels are not your preferred footwear, don’t feel obligated to wear them. There are plenty of stylish and comfortable flats or wedges that can complement your gown equally well.

Remember, the most important aspect of your quinceañera outfit is that it makes you feel confident and radiant. Whether you choose to rent, purchase, or borrow your gown, the key is to find an outfit that reflects your unique style and allows you to shine on your special day. With a little creativity and resourcefulness, you can achieve a budget-friendly quinceañera look that will leave a lasting impression.

Q&A

**Questions and Answers about What to Wear to a Quinceañera:**

1. **What is the dress code for a quinceañera?**
– Formal attire, typically floor-length gowns for girls and suits or tuxedos for boys.

2. **What colors are appropriate for a quinceañera dress?**
– Traditional colors include white, pink, blue, and yellow, but any color is acceptable.

3. **What type of fabric is best for a quinceañera dress?**
– Luxurious fabrics such as silk, satin, lace, and organza are popular choices.

4. **What accessories should I wear with my quinceañera dress?**
– Jewelry, such as a necklace, earrings, and bracelet; a tiara or headpiece; and a clutch bag.

5. **What shoes should I wear with my quinceañera dress?**
– Heels or wedges that complement the dress and provide support for dancing.

6. **What should boys wear to a quinceañera?**
– A suit or tuxedo in a dark color, such as black, navy, or gray.

7. **Can I wear a short dress to a quinceañera?**
– While floor-length gowns are traditional, shorter dresses are becoming more acceptable.

8. **What should I wear if I am a guest at a quinceañera?**
– Dressy attire, such as a cocktail dress or a dressy pantsuit.

9. **Is it appropriate to wear jeans to a quinceañera?**
– No, jeans are not considered appropriate attire for a quinceañera.

10. **What should I avoid wearing to a quinceañera?**
– Casual clothing, such as shorts, t-shirts, or sneakers; revealing or inappropriate clothing; and clothing that is too white or too similar to the quinceañera’s dress.
